In April of 2015, my son was born and I decided to stay at home with him. I was excited to get the chance to implement what I had learned through experience with other little ones. I felt ready. I could do this! I would do everything the books said and everything would go perfectly. I would get him to fall asleep on his own, take long naps, and sleep through the night super quickly. That was my plan before he was born. Well, I did help him learn how to put himself to sleep independently from a young age, but he did not sleep through the night naturally and I couldn't for the life of me figure out how to get him to nap past 37 minutes. 37 minute naps?!? It drove me crazy! I know there are moms out there that feel the same way. How could I get other babies to sleep through the night and take long naps, but not my own son?
I reached out to Katie Pitts with Sleep Wise Consulting. I stuck with my plan and after a short period of time my son started sleeping through the night and taking longer naps. The relief became a passion to help other moms out there who are wondering how to get their baby to sleep longer than 30-90 minute increments.
